Overview
The Siemens SQM10.16502 is a high-performance, reversible electromotoric actuator designed for the precise positioning of air dampers and control valves in gas and oil burners. Engineered for industrial and commercial combustion systems, this robust servo motor ensures optimal fuel-to-air ratios, enhancing combustion efficiency and operational safety. It features a locking-proof synchronous motor and a durable gear train housed in die-cast aluminum with an impact-resistant plastic cover, making it suitable for demanding environments.
Features
- Reversible synchronous motor that is locking-proof, ensuring reliable performance under load
- Integrated cam stack with 2 end switches and 5 auxiliary switches for flexible control configurations
- Manual adjustment of switching points using setting scales and adjustable cams
- Maintenance-free reduction gearing equipped with self-lubricating sinter-bronze bearings
- Internal scale for precise position monitoring and adjustment during setup
- Durable construction with a die-cast aluminum housing and IP54 protection rating
Specifications
- Model: SQM10.16502
- Operating Voltage: AC 220 V to 240 V (+10% / -15%), 50/60 Hz
- Nominal Torque: 10 Nm
- Starting Torque: 15 Nm
- Running Time: 29 seconds for 90 degrees; 42 seconds for 130 degrees (at 50 Hz)
- Direction of Rotation: Counterclockwise (facing the drive shaft)
- Power Consumption: 9 VA
- Protection Class: IP54
- Weight: Approximately 1.7 kg (3.7 lbs)
- Operating Temperature: -20 C to +60 C
Applications
- Precise control of air dampers in industrial burner systems
- Regulation of gas and oil flow via control valves for optimal combustion
- Integration with burner controllers and switching devices equipped with changeover contacts
- Use in HVAC systems, boiler plants, and manufacturing facilities requiring high-torque automation
- Suitable for systems utilizing 4-20 mA signals when paired with appropriate electronic controllers
